In an 8-ounce or larger mason jar, combine the lemon juice, olive oil, mustard, garlic, oregano, salt, and black pepper. Stir well with a whisk or spoon. Or, secure the lid on the jar and shake well until the dressing looks emulsified.
This dressing tastes best if you can let it rest at least 10 minutes before serving, so the flavors can meld. Leftovers can be stored in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 5 days.
